Output 866371837dd7e7b5f8a9677ea561b69fae46c31b50848cf00cd35c987e73414f:0

value
7095000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889a1a834490cb52d9330cc12702c87b5c35405f OP_EQUALVERIFY OP_CHECKSIG
address
1DTHWPkxpSzQkHuinKWyZJsy5dSBd4PkEu
transaction
866371837dd7e7b5f8a9677ea561b69fae46c31b50848cf00cd35c987e73414f
spent
true